I recently bought a 92 750sx and it has a CDK II 38mm carb in it. It has a factory pipe and K&N air filter plus some other fun stuff unrelated to the engine. When I bought it, it would absolutely rocket out of the hole at about 1/3 throttle but if you stayed above 1/3 throttle for more than a second or two it would bog down and die. The transition was always very smooth but it wouldn't last. Also if I rode it continously for a few minutes at low throttle it would get twitchy and/or die.
I decided that a carb rebuild was in order so I got one from SBTontheweb (very poor quality kit IMHO). No carb to intake manifold gasket, not all the o-rings were included, and there were parts that didn't fit my carb left over. Anyway, after the rebuild it wouldn't run at all with the new pop off spring. I put the old spring back in and it ran better but still much worse than before. Now I can get it to idle but the rpms systematically go up and down to what sounds like about 700-1000 rpms. I used RTV to seal the carb to the intake manifold so I'm wondering if that's the cause of that problem. At the same time I can't tune the carb to save my life. The best I ever got it tuned, it would ease through the rpms if I did it slowly and would top out but then it would fall back down seconds later. If I rode it slowly with that setup it would go normal and then out of nowhere, it would practically throw me off the back of the ski when it went WOT without me changing throttle position.
I can't figure this out to save my life. I'm wondering if I'm just missing something with the pop off springs or needle settings or whether the kit and a leak between carb and intake could be causing all of this.
